Fiber optic cable installation involves setting up high-speed data transmission lines that use thin strands of glass or plastic to carry light signals. This process typically includes planning the layout, running the cables through walls, underground, or along exterior surfaces, and connecting them to existing networks or devices. Skilled service providers ensure that the cables are properly secured, protected from damage, and configured for optimal performance. This type of installation is essential for establishing fast, reliable internet, phone, and data services in residential or commercial properties.

Many common problems can be addressed through fiber optic cable installation. Traditional copper wiring may struggle with bandwidth limitations, resulting in slow internet speeds and frequent disruptions. Fiber optics provide significantly higher capacity, reducing lag and buffering during online activities, streaming, or remote work. Additionally, fiber cables are less susceptible to electromagnetic interference, which can cause signal degradation. Installing fiber optics can improve overall connectivity stability, especially in areas with high network congestion or where existing wiring is outdated or insufficient.

The overview below groups typical Fiber Optic Cable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fiber optic cable repairs or extensions range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Standard Installations - Installing fiber optic cables in residential or small commercial settings us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common and often stay within this typical range, though larger setups can cost more.

Full System Upgrades - Upgrading or replacing existing fiber optic networks can range from $3,500 to $7,500 depending on the scale and complexity.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.

Large-Scale Projects - Extensive fiber optic installation for multi-building or industrial sites can exceed $10,000, with some complex deployments reaching $20,000 or more. While less common, these larger projects typically involve significant planning and resources.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is fiber optic cable installation? Fiber optic cable installation involves setting up high-speed cables that transmit data using light signals, supporting faster internet and communication networks.

What types of fiber optic cables are available for installation? There are various types of fiber optic cables, including single-mode and multi-mode cables, each suited for different distances and applications.

What factors influence the complexity of fiber optic cable installation? The complexity can depend on the building layout, the distance the cable needs to cover, and the specific infrastructure requirements of the project.

How do local contractors ensure proper fiber optic cable installation? They follow industry standards for handling, splicing, and testing cables to ensure optimal performance and reliability.

What should be considered when planning fiber optic cable installation? Planning involves assessing the site, determining the best routing paths, and coordinating with other building systems to ensure seamless integration.
